For many, the first port of call in London's gay dating scene is their smartphone. Apps have revolutionized how we meet, offering unparalleled convenience and a vast pool of potential connections. They cater to a wide range of intentions, from casual hookups to more serious dating prospects.
Apps like Grindr, Scruff, and to a lesser extent, mainstream platforms like Tinder and OkCupid, are often the go-to for those seeking quick, no-strings-attached encounters or spontaneous meetups. They provide immediate access to profiles based on proximity, allowing for rapid communication and arrangement.
"In the fast-paced London lifestyle, these apps offer a convenient shortcut to connection, whether it's for a casual chat, a quick date, or something more intimate. They can be particularly useful for travelers looking to meet locals and explore the city's queer-friendly spots."
However, the convenience comes with its own set of challenges. Users often report a sense of superficiality, "app fatigue," and the occasional frustration with profile authenticity or a lack of meaningful engagement. While some apps like Scruff attempt to foster a sense of community through features, the primary user experience often remains transaction-oriented.
While often associated with casual encounters, many gay men successfully use these same apps to cultivate genuine friendships, find social groups, or even pursue long-term relationships. It often comes down to communication and a clear understanding of what both parties are seeking.
The key is to use the app as a starting point, transitioning quickly to real-world interactions to gauge genuine compatibility. Remember, a digital profile is just a snapshot; true connection blossoms in person.
Despite the dominance of apps, traditional and contemporary offline dating methods remain incredibly popular and often yield more organic, lasting connections. London's vibrant scene offers numerous physical spaces and events designed for gay men to meet and mingle.
London's gay village, particularly in Soho, boasts a legendary array of bars, pubs, and clubs. These venues offer a social atmosphere where spontaneous connections can form. From a relaxed drink in a cozy pub to a night of dancing in a bustling club, these spaces provide an unscripted environment for meeting new people.
For those who prefer a more organized approach, gay speed dating events have become increasingly popular. These events offer a series of short, timed "mini-dates" in a relaxed setting, allowing participants to meet numerous singles in one evening.
Beyond speed dating, London hosts a myriad of LGBTQ+ events, from cultural festivals and film screenings to sports leagues and community gatherings. These provide excellent opportunities to meet like-minded individuals through shared interests, fostering connections that often go deeper than a simple swipe.
